document.write( "Question 1135355: A landscaping company needs 120 gallons of 13​% fertilizer to fertilize the shrubs in an office park. They have in stock 20​% fertilizer and 10​% fertilizer. How much of each type should they mix​ together? \n" ); document.write( "

document.write( "Let x = the amount of the 20% fertilizer (in gallons) and y = the amount of the 10% fertilizer.\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"Then you have two equations\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"         x +     y = 120       gallons  of the mixture                (1)\r\n" );
document.write( "and\r\n" );
document.write( "     0.20x + 0.10y = 0.13*120  gallons  of the pure  fertilizer       (2)\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"So, your system of equations is THIS\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"         x +     y = 120         (1)\r\n" );
document.write( "\r\n" );
document.write( "     0.20x + 0.10y = 0.13*120    (2)\r\n" );
document.write( "         \r\n" );
document.write( "\r\n" );
document.write( "It can be solved by Substitution or Elimination method, on your choice.\r\n" );
document.write( "\r\n" );
document.write( "If you solve by Elimination, multiply eq(1) by 0.2 (both sides) and keep eq(2) as is, with no change. You will get\r\n" );
document.write( "\r\n" );
document.write( "      \r\n" );
document.write( "     0.20x + 0.20y = 0.20*120    (1')\r\n" );
document.write( "\r\n" );
document.write( "     0.20x + 0.10y = 0.13*120    (2)\r\n" );
document.write( "\r\n" );
document.write( "----------------------------------------- Now subtract eq(2) from eq(1')\r\n" );
document.write( "\r\n" );
document.write( "                                          The terms \" 0.20x \" will cancel each other, and you will get\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"             0.20y - 0.10y = 0.20*120 - 0.13*120,   \r\n" );
document.write( "\r\n" );
document.write( "which gives you\r\n" );
document.write( "\r\n" );
document.write( "             y = \"%280.20%2A120+-+0.13%2A120%29%2F%280.20+-+0.10%29\" = one click in my Excel = 84.\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"ANSWER.  84 gallons of the 10% fertilizer and  the rest (120-84) = 36 gallons of the 20% fertilizer.\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"CHECK.  0.1*84 + 0.2*36 = 15.6 gallons of the pure fertilizer = 0.13*120.   ! Correct !\r\n" );
